When she opened the door, the person in the room happened to raise his head, and when his eyes met, the other person suddenly took a breath; in the cool and dark room, the sound was sharp and clear.

Lin Sanjiu reached out and touched her face. "…What's wrong?"

Does she look scary?

It's not like he was staring at her so unblinkingly...

The girl was stunned for two seconds, then hurriedly came to her senses, her face flushed, her eyes shining brightly, as if her hands and feet suddenly had nowhere to put them.

"No, it's okay! I just didn't expect that you, you really showed up... I mean, you were actually a person - well, that doesn't seem right. I, I wanted to say, I didn't expect that you could actually see it. You-you, do you drink tea? Let me clear the table and pour you some tea!"

Lin Sanjiu stood there, closed the door, and watched her spinning around in the room: when she was about to pick up an old-fashioned TV, she knocked over a stack of books; when she was getting a chair for Lin Sanjiu, she bumped into it with her foot. table legs.

She curled up and groaned in pain: "My toes..."

The toes of the evolutionaries are also very painful when bumped.

"You're welcome, I don't drink tea." Lin Sanjiu had to suppress her suspicions and said, "Why did you see me excited? Aren't you the one who came to me?"

"Yep…"

"Your name is..." Lin Sanjiu recalled the name she saw in the communication system, "Wei Junye, right?"

"Yes," the girl looked up at Lin Sanjiu. She probably didn't even know she had a smile on her face - obviously, her mouth and brain were out of touch. "Yes, I was looking for you, but I didn't expect to actually see you... Today is a good day, I saw Lin Sanjiu! Seeing you up close, it's really... ah, far better than what I have always expected Your imagination.”

How is this going?

Lin Sanjiu murmured something in his stomach. Firstly, she is not Qing Jiuru, and secondly, she is not the Loch Ness Monster. Why is she acting like a fan meeting a celebrity?

"Honestly, I still have a lot of questions about today's transaction." Lin Sanjiu asked, "Did you know who I am first and then ask for a deal with me? Are you here just for me?"

Wei Junye didn't seem to think that his behavior was suspicious at all, and immediately nodded: "That's right!"

"…Why?"

Lin Sanjiu really wanted to be on guard, but couldn't. If this was a trap, it would be too shallow. "How do you know me? I am not famous in the Twelve Realms."

"Ah, that's true... but I didn't find out about you through ordinary channels."

Wei Junye swept the chair with his sleeves, and after Lin Sanjiu sat down, he said, "Let me explain it to you from the beginning?"

Lin Sanjiu raised her hand in a "please" gesture.

"About five or six months ago, I developed a new ability called [Experience is the most valuable asset]."

[Experience is the most valuable wealth]

After all, there are limits to what a person can do, the path he can take, and the things he can learn in his lifetime. In the vast and bizarre apocalyptic world, relying solely on your own experience will inevitably lead to unexpected events... So, if you can accumulate the experience of others, wouldn't it greatly increase your chances of survival?

Passive abilities. Once generated, the ability owner will observe in his sleep every night the crises, copies, dilemmas that a random evolver has experienced... and her/his method of solving the problem.

PS: This ability is mainly for learning and not for prying into other people's privacy. Therefore, the scenes shown in the dream are limited to when the target evolver is in public; for example, a copy of a solo game, unfortunately, will not emerge from the dream.

…Lin Sanjiu vaguely understood.

"Because you are very unlucky," Wei Junye said matter-of-factly. "You always run into some life-threatening difficulties. In addition, you have a lot of friends around you. Generally speaking, it is not a private place, so I dream about you so often. You are always higher than others...I have learned a lot from you during this period, thank you."

Lin Sanjiu thought for a while and said, "...You're welcome?"

Wei Junye lowered his head again and said, "I've seen a lot, and I think you're awesome... Well, no one else is like me, who goes to bed on time at ten o'clock in the evening... They think it's strange, but they don't know, I There is a strong motivation to sleep!”

This girl won't like me, right?

As the thought came together, Lin Sanjiu suddenly felt ashamed - she was so arrogant, she was not Qing Jiuliu.

"I even know a few of your friends... I know you really want to find your friends. Because of my dream, I happened to know the whereabouts of one of them, so I proposed a deal with you."

"Who is it?" Lin Sanjiu sat upright.

"You will know soon." Wei Junye coughed into his fist and said, "I am willing to take you to find him. After you meet, I hope you can fulfill one of my wishes..."

"What wish?" Lin Sanjiu felt that her image might have been beautified by Wei Junye's dream, and reminded her in advance: "My abilities are also very limited..."

"You can definitely do this," Wei Junye said very sincerely.

*

Lin Sanjiu stood on the stone road, looking at the castle in the hazy mist in the distance, not turning a corner for a while.

"I don't understand," she had to ask again, "You mean, the person is trapped by the copy, but he himself... is happy?"

"Yes," Wei Junye stared at the outline of the castle with a growl in his throat. "I walked through this dungeon with another evolver in my dream... It is different from ordinary dungeons. Its danger does not lie in traps or battles... If you want to leave, you can leave at any time. But once people fall into the dungeon, they will It will start to indulge and sink willingly, blend in seamlessly with the surrounding environment, and not want to leave at all, so in the end it can only become a duplicate creature."

"I understand, you have been brainwashed!" Lin Sanjiu patted Wei Junye on the shoulder and almost couldn't help laughing: "It's okay, I know how to deal with it. If it doesn't work, I can wash it back with just a scoop. He is very experienced in this area. Hey, don’t tell me, Karma’s power is really quite powerful..."

"As expected of you," the girl said in admiration almost out of habit. She said the words, but hesitated. "However, I don't think it's the same as brainwashing..."

"Why are the methods different?" Lin Sanjiu asked.

"After all, I just watched other people walk through it in my dream. I have no personal experience," she said sheepishly, "It's just a feeling..."

*

This dungeon has quite some rules. There is a table at the gate, and on the table is a challenge sign-in book. Lin Sanjiu wrote down her name honestly, and the iron door creaked and slowly slid open.

*

It's strange. When I looked at the castle from outside the iron gate just now... was it floating in mid-air?

The iron gate is like a dividing line. Once you step through the gate, you step into the dark clouds and thick fog. The sky was pressed to the ground, breathless; but a large piece of the ground was forcibly pulled out and plunged into the dark green clouds and mist. The castle it carries floats in the sky, making it even more shadowy.

The grass that was as tall as two people looked down at the two people walking between them; Lin Sanjiu looked back and found that the path he came from had been covered by the grass that had closed up again.

She continued to push away the grass, and a huge, white half-moon appeared from the ground between the grass, as if it had been waiting for her for a long time.

Lin Sanjiu's heartbeat skipped a beat as soon as the moon and man met each other. She looked at the half of the moon that seemed to be able to swallow her in one bite, but did not come closer. She waited nervously for a few seconds, and finally changed direction. After the grass was closed, the moon sitting on the ground was still glowing faintly.

"What's going on, this place," she whispered, "did you hear the music? Where did it come from? It's vague..."

Wei Junye's face was whiter than the moon just now. "I, I, I heard it, what was that? It seemed like something from the horse-horse circus..."

The two of them avoided the direction of the music, made a circle, and continued walking towards the castle in mid-air. Under the uprooted land mass, there is a bottomless black abyss. Surrounding the edge of the black abyss, large, rich, feathery black-red flowers grow, swaying gently in the mist.

"How to go up?" Lin Sanjiu raised her head and realized that the castle in the sky was floating very high, so high that even the evolved ones were worried.

"I don't know either…"

"Didn't you follow someone else through it once?"

"Yes, but the last copy didn't look like this..." Wei Junye explained, "Last time it was a beach and grassland, not even a castle."

She is of no use co-authoring.

*

"I still have to go out and bring the aircraft in?"

Lin Sanjiu could only think of this solution and couldn't help but look back at the way he came. At some point, dark, dry tall trees gradually emerged from the grass; their slender branches were criss-crossed, like finger bones with peeled flesh.

Wei Junye beside him suddenly took a deep breath.

Lin Sanjiu suddenly turned her head, and a black shadow fell down in front of her eyes. She was shocked, and as soon as she was ready to fight, she only heard a "pop" sound. After the black shadow fell straight into the abyss, it seemed to hit the ground. on something.

Under the unblinking gaze of the two men, a huge smooth wooden surface slowly rose from the abyss. The black figure seemed to be an evolutionist covered in blood—the reason why I said "seemingly" was because before Lin Sanjiu had time to see clearly, the wooden surface had been gently turned over, and it was sent into a blank and flat table at the back. face.

"This, this is..." Wei Junye stammered and couldn't continue.

Lin Sanjiu raised his head and looked at the castle in the sky, and then at the wooden face in front of him.

A humanoid wooden sculpture the size of a building slowly climbed up from the abyss; a pair of eyes with empty eye sockets but no pupils faced the two fist-sized people in front of them.

"Did it eat that person?" Wei Junye asked in a low voice.

"Can you tell where the mouth is?" Lin Sanjiu asked back.

No matter where the black shadow went, the humanoid wooden sculptures in front of them didn't seem to have the intention of eating them. The huge smooth wooden surface turned over again, and stretched out its pillar-like fingers, resting on their feet.

With the other hand, he pointed towards the castle above.

"Are you going to send us up?" Lin Sanjiu was surprised this time, "Why does the dungeon still have this service?"

If the evolver who fell just now was sent to the high-altitude castle in the same way, then maybe the humanoid wood sculpture was not serving, but just sending the visitor to a dead end.

Having said that, Lin Sanjiu climbed onto the wooden palm cautiously; what surprised her was that Wei Junye didn't seem too scared, and followed neatly with his hands and feet and turned into the wooden palm.

After standing on the wooden palm, the humanoid wood sculpture slowly began to stand up.

It carried the two of them all the way up; Lin Sanjiu watched as the abyss and the earth got farther and farther away from him, and the floating island in mid-air got closer and closer. The mist drifted away, gradually revealing the castle.

Her eyes moved across the floating island, across the ground, and landed on a long, narrow and towering gate. Inside the gate, there seemed to be a dark ground; as Lin Sanjiu rose higher and higher, her eyes followed the carpet and finally stopped on a high seat in the deepest part.

A dark figure was leaning on the seat, with a dark light shining on his long leather boots.

From the armrest of the seat, a pale and thin hand hung down. The fingertips gently stirred the dim and dark air, and each stroke seemed to hit the invisible nerves, causing the shadows floating between the sky and the earth to tremble.

...Lin Sanjiu stared blankly at the pair of eyes that seemed to be sunk in a sea of ​​bloody red, and realized that the puppet master seemed to be in a very good mood.
